Analog to Digital Converters (ADC) Analog Devices, Inc. AD7660ASTZ Overview
Introducing the AD7660ASTZ, a state-of-the-art 16-bit SAR ADC from Analog Devices, Inc. This high-performance analog to digital converter ensures precision data conversion with its superior 16-bit resolution. Engineered for reliability and accuracy, the AD7660ASTZ is optimized for advanced signal processing applications where data integrity is crucial. With its robust design and the backing of Analog Devices' pioneering technology, this product is ideal for high-demand environments seeking efficient and precise analog-to-digital conversion.
AD7660ASTZ Features
The AD7660ASTZ ADC boasts a fast sampling rate and low power consumption, making it suitable for a wide range of applications. Its features include a 48LQFP package, ensuring compact integration into existing designs without sacrificing performance. The device's inherent stability and precision make it a primary choice for developers looking to enhance system accuracy and extend operational life.
AD7660ASTZ Applications
- Medical Imaging: In medical imaging systems, the AD7660ASTZ captures high-fidelity analog signals, converting them into digital data for precise imaging diagnostics.
- Test and Measurement Equipment: This ADC offers the accuracy needed in test and measurement setups to ensure reliable and consistent data outputs.
- Data Acquisition Systems: Ideal for data-heavy environments, the AD7660ASTZ ensures seamless conversion of analog inputs into digital form, enhancing both the storage and analysis of data.
- Communication Systems: In communication devices, accurate ADCs like the AD7660ASTZ are crucial for converting analog signals (such as sound waves) into digital data, maintaining signal integrity and clarity.
